Attendees: full exec group. Rennick reported that our single-source dependency for the Halveon valve assembly remains the top operational risk. Two candidate second-source suppliers have passed initial audits; a third, based near Dunsbrook, is under review. Qualification samples are expected within six weeks. Finance confirmed budget headroom for dual tooling. The board is asked to note the timeline and approve the audit spend at the next session. The confidential note on related business plans appears below.

management briefing: Silethax Systems plans to raise the Holix list price by 50.2 percent in December. The steering committee signed off on a budget of $329.9 million for Project Holok. The renewal with Juldorax Foods closes at $278.2 million a year, 54.3 percent above the last contract. Project Briir slips by one quarter because of the supplier delay.

MEMO — Sales Leads

Our supply contract with Tarnow Fabrication renews at the end of the quarter. Pricing holds flat for year one, with a volume rebate from year two. Lead times improve by roughly a week. Quote accordingly, but hold larger commitments until the renewal is signed. See the confidential note below.

internal memo for kawip-hadug: Headcount on the Wenwyn team goes from 7 to 140 by the end of January. Gross margin on Wenwyn came in at 20 percent against a plan of 15 percent.

Subject: Fire Drill Thursday — Roll Call Duties

Hi reception team,

Quick reminder: the quarterly fire drill at Pellam House runs this Thursday at 10:30. When the alarm sounds, grab the visitor log and clipboard, head to the muster point by the bike shed, and tick off everyone against the sign-in sheet. Don't forget the Aldercroft Media crew on level three — they're new and tend to wander.

Afterwards, you'll need to re-arm the lobby doors. Use the reset code below.

door code, yagap-bahof: bdg-O-05

## Deployment

The Mergewell dedupe service runs as a nightly batch plus an on-demand trigger. If you're on call and someone pages about duplicate customer records, don't panic — the matcher is conservative by design and will only auto-merge above the confidence threshold. Everything below that lands in the review queue for the Ashdown ops crew. Deploys are blue-green; flip traffic only after the warm-up pass completes. The service reads the following configuration at startup.

settings of fajop-fahap:
[holeth]
port = 9300
team = juleth
host = holeth.tolvaqsoft.example
region = south-4
access_code = ac_4bcdf6
timeout_ms = 500